    Used to work right next to a Fry's, have never seen a more miserable group of employees in my whole life. Talked to a couple of them from time to time who had nothing but bad things to say about working there.

    Regarding Best Buy this is a smart move by them at the end of the day, although my understanding is some of the people let go were definitely cost-cutting terminations which could hurt them from an operations perspective.

    Finally related to sales tax on eCommerce purchases - it's a state-by-state issue and in general it only depends on whether the online retailer has a physical presence in the state (i.e a product distribution center). There is no federal "eCommerce tax" law and one doesn't look likely anytime soon.
